Title of article :
Influence of acidic strength on the catalytic activity of Brّnsted acidic ionic liquids on synthesizing cyclic carbonate from carbon dioxide and epoxide

Abstract :
The chemical fixation of CO2 with epoxides to form cyclic carbonates was carried out with excellent selectivity and yield in the presence of Brّnsted acidic ionic liquids without using additional organic solvents and co-catalyst. The acidic strength of ionic liquids was determined and its effect on the synthesis of cyclic carbonates was investigated. The reaction conditions (temperature, CO2 pressure and reaction time) were optimized, and the Brّnsted acidic ionic liquids showed highly catalytic activity under the optimal reaction conditions. A plausible reaction mechanism was suggested and it was demonstrated that the carboxylic group in Brّnsted acidic ionic liquids had synergetic effect with halide. Moreover, the catalyst could be used five times without significant decrease in its catalytic activity.
